Another Russian Warship Blown Up In Sevastopol Harbor

The ship is a carrier of "Kalibrs".

Another Russian warship has been blown up near Sevastopol in Russian-occupied Crimea.

The explosion occurred in the morning on Friday, October 13.

This was reported by the "Crimean Wind" Telegram-channel with reference to the residents of the peninsula. According to its data, the sound of the explosion was heard even in the centre of Sevastopol.

"Just now a ship was blown up in the Sevastopol harbour. The explosion was felt even by residents of the city centre, car alarms were activated," the report said.

Apparently, a small missile ship of the 21631 project, Buyan-M, a carrier of Kalibr missiles, exploded and was smoking, Crimean Wind specified.

The 21631 project Buyan-M small missile ships are a series of Russian multi-purpose small missile and artillery ships of the 3rd rank of small displacement with guided missile armament of the river-sea class near-sea zone.

The official purpose of the ships of this project is to protect and defend the economic zone of the state in inland sea basins. There are 10 such ships in the Russian Navy.

We remind you that yesterday it became known that a ship of the Russian Black Sea Fleet of the class frigate 'Pavel Derzhavin' was blown up and damaged near occupied Sevastopol.
